http://wenku.baidu.com/view/f27502d5c1c708a1284a4410.html
Oracle企业管理器错误:
==================================
企业管理器地址;
http://localhost:1158/em/
启动管理器首先要启动服务OracleDBConsole
1.启动企业管理器,需要主机身份认证和数据库认证,输入后报错:
RemoteOperationException: ERROR: Wrong password for user
现象:无论怎么输入用户名和密码都报错。
原因:操作系统用户权限问题
解决方法:oracle10g要进行主机身份验证
1、从开始——进入设置——控制面板——管理工具 找到本地安全策略
2、打开本地安全策略,找到本地策略
3、打开其中的用户权限分配
4、在右边的列表中找到“作为批处理作业登录
5、选中,点击右键,选择属性,将数据库安装的所在操作系统用户,添加其中即可
6、然后应用、确定。
7、下次就使用安装oracle的os用户及相应的口令进行主机身份证明即可。
备注: 为windows用户添加密码,没有密码是不可以的。 从开始——进入设置——控制面板--用户账号。 添加一个密码就可以了。
==================================
1.OracleDBConsoleorcl 服务启动错误
1.1 描述:
OracleDBConsoleorcl 服务因 2 (0x2) 服务性错误而停止
1.2.现象:
OEM(Oracle Enterprise Manager)可以正常打开在打开OEM的网页控制台,实际上很多人也都会遇到在刚安装好的时候可以打开,
但是在之后(系统环境发生了变化)可能就会出现无法打开网页控制台的情况。
本质:IP环境变化
在cmd命令控制台输入:
C:\Documents and Settings\Administrator>set oracle_sid=orcl
C:\Documents and Settings\joe>emctl start dbconsole
OC4J Configuration issue. D:\develop\oracle\product\10.2.0\db_1/oc4j/j2ee/OC4J_D
BConsole_kingdom-437fe9d_orcl not found.
可以看到提示说OC4J_DBConsole_kingdom-437fe9d_orcl not found.
进入相关目录查看,发现的是一个以机器名称+ORACLE_SID的文件夹,
D:\oracle\product\10.2.0\db_1\oc4j\j2ee\OC4J_DBConsole_lvxd_orcl
1.3.原因
对照现象分析了一下,是网络域名配置问题。
oracle在安装时若有网络环境会生成OC4J_DBConsole _kingdom-437fe9d_orcl(kingdom-437fe9d是我的主机名),若无网络环境会生成OC4J_DBConsole _localhost_orcl,
1.4.解决方法
复制OC4J_DBConsole _localhost_orcl文件夹,并且改名为OC4J_DBConsole _kingdom-437fe9d_orcl即可。
==================================
1.描述:
Enterprise Manager 无法连接到数据库实例。
1.1 现象
登陆https://localhost:1158/em 之后,看到数据库实例都是关闭的.启动不了.
1.2 原因:
本质:IP环境变化
1.3 解决:
进入dos
(1)查看dbconsole状态:emctl status dbconsole
C:\Documents and Settings\joe>emctl status dbconsole
EM Configuration issue. D:\develop\oracle\product\10.2.0\db_1/kingdom-437fe9d_orcl not found.
将localhost_orcl文件修改为:
复制localhost_orcl文件夹并且改名为kingdom-437fe9d_orcl
(3)重新配置em : emca -config dbcontrol db
C:\Documents and Settings\whtai>emca -config dbcontrol db
EMCA 开始于 2009-8-31 16:48:45
EM Configuration Assistant, 11.1.0.5.0 正式版
版权所有 (c) 2003, 2005, Oracle。保留所有权利。
输入以下信息:
数据库 SID: orcl
已为数据库 orcl 配置了 Database Control
您已选择配置 Database Control, 以便管理数据库 orcl
此操作将移去现有配置和默认设置, 并重新执行配置
是否继续? [是(Y)/否(N)]: y
监听程序端口号: 1521
SYS 用户的口令:
DBSNMP 用户的口令: 56
SYSMAN 用户的口令:
通知的电子邮件地址 (可选):
通知的发件 (SMTP) 服务器 (可选):
-----------------------------------------------------------------
已指定以下设置
数据库 ORACLE_HOME ................ C:\app\whtai\product\11.1.0\db_1
本地主机名 ................ 192.168.11.74
监听程序端口号 ................ 1521
数据库 SID ................ orcl
通知的电子邮件地址 ...............
通知的发件 (SMTP) 服务器 ...............
-----------------------------------------------------------------
是否继续? [是(Y)/否(N)]: y
2009-8-31 16:51:07 oracle.sysman.emcp.EMConfig perform
信息: 正在将此操作记录到 C:\app\whtai\cfgtoollogs\emca\orcl\emca_2009_08_31_16_4
8_44.log。
2009-8-31 16:51:36 oracle.sysman.emcp.util.DBControlUtil stopOMS
信息: 正在停止 Database Control (此操作可能需要一段时间)...
2009-8-31 16:53:34 oracle.sysman.emcp.EMReposConfig uploadConfigDataToRepository
信息: 正在将配置数据上载到 EM 资料档案库 (此操作可能需要一段时间)...
2009-8-31 16:56:44 oracle.sysman.emcp.EMReposConfig invoke
信息: 已成功上载配置数据
2009-8-31 16:56:58 oracle.sysman.emcp.util.DBControlUtil configureSoftwareLib
信息: 软件库已配置。
2009-8-31 16:56:58 oracle.sysman.emcp.util.DBControlUtil configureSoftwareLib
信息: 将忽略 EM_SWLIB_STAGE_LOC (值)。
2009-8-31 16:56:59 oracle.sysman.emcp.util.DBControlUtil secureDBConsole
信息: 正在保护 Database Control (此操作可能需要一段时间)...
2009-8-31 16:57:15 oracle.sysman.emcp.util.DBControlUtil secureDBConsole
信息: 已成功保护 Database Control。
2009-8-31 16:57:15 oracle.sysman.emcp.util.DBControlUtil startOMS
信息: 正在启动 Database Control (此操作可能需要一段时间)...
2009-8-31 16:59:16 oracle.sysman.emcp.EMDBPostConfig performConfiguration
信息: 已成功启动 Database Control
2009-8-31 16:59:18 oracle.sysman.emcp.EMDBPostConfig performConfiguration
信息: >>>>>>>>>>> Database Control URL 为 https://192.168.11.74:1158/em <<<<<<<<
<<<
2009-8-31 16:59:29 oracle.sysman.emcp.EMDBPostConfig invoke
警告:
************************ WARNING ************************
管理资料档案库已置于安全模式下, 在此模式下将对 Enterprise Manager 数据进行加密。
加密密钥已放置在文件 C:\app\whtai\product\11.1.0\db_1\192.168.11.74_orcl\sysman\
config\emkey.ora 中。请务必备份此文件, 因为如果此文件丢失, 则加密数据将不可用。
***********************************************************
已成功完成 Enterprise Manager 的配置
EMCA 结束于 2009-8-31 16:59:29
Oracle企业管理器错误:
==================================
企业管理器地址;
http://localhost:1158/em/
启动管理器首先要启动服务OracleDBConsole
1.启动企业管理器,需要主机身份认证和数据库认证,输入后报错:
RemoteOperationException: ERROR: Wrong password for user
现象:无论怎么输入用户名和密码都报错。
原因:操作系统用户权限问题
解决方法:oracle10g要进行主机身份验证
1、从开始——进入设置——控制面板——管理工具 找到本地安全策略
2、打开本地安全策略,找到本地策略
3、打开其中的用户权限分配
4、在右边的列表中找到“作为批处理作业登录
5、选中,点击右键,选择属性,将数据库安装的所在操作系统用户,添加其中即可
6、然后应用、确定。
7、下次就使用安装oracle的os用户及相应的口令进行主机身份证明即可。
备注: 为windows用户添加密码,没有密码是不可以的。 从开始——进入设置——控制面板--用户账号。 添加一个密码就可以了。
==================================
1.OracleDBConsoleorcl 服务启动错误
1.1 描述:
OracleDBConsoleorcl 服务因 2 (0x2) 服务性错误而停止
1.2.现象:
OEM(Oracle Enterprise Manager)可以正常打开在打开OEM的网页控制台,实际上很多人也都会遇到在刚安装好的时候可以打开,
但是在之后(系统环境发生了变化)可能就会出现无法打开网页控制台的情况。
本质:IP环境变化
在cmd命令控制台输入:
C:\Documents and Settings\Administrator>set oracle_sid=orcl
C:\Documents and Settings\joe>emctl start dbconsole
OC4J Configuration issue. D:\develop\oracle\product\10.2.0\db_1/oc4j/j2ee/OC4J_D
BConsole_kingdom-437fe9d_orcl not found.
可以看到提示说OC4J_DBConsole_kingdom-437fe9d_orcl not found.
进入相关目录查看,发现的是一个以机器名称+ORACLE_SID的文件夹,
D:\oracle\product\10.2.0\db_1\oc4j\j2ee\OC4J_DBConsole_lvxd_orcl
1.3.原因
对照现象分析了一下,是网络域名配置问题。
oracle在安装时若有网络环境会生成OC4J_DBConsole _kingdom-437fe9d_orcl(kingdom-437fe9d是我的主机名),若无网络环境会生成OC4J_DBConsole _localhost_orcl,
1.4.解决方法
复制OC4J_DBConsole _localhost_orcl文件夹,并且改名为OC4J_DBConsole _kingdom-437fe9d_orcl即可。
==================================
1.描述:
Enterprise Manager 无法连接到数据库实例。
1.1 现象
登陆https://localhost:1158/em 之后,看到数据库实例都是关闭的.启动不了.
1.2 原因:
本质:IP环境变化
1.3 解决:
进入dos
(1)查看dbconsole状态:emctl status dbconsole
C:\Documents and Settings\joe>emctl status dbconsole
EM Configuration issue. D:\develop\oracle\product\10.2.0\db_1/kingdom-437fe9d_orcl not found.
将localhost_orcl文件修改为:
复制localhost_orcl文件夹并且改名为kingdom-437fe9d_orcl
(3)重新配置em : emca -config dbcontrol db
C:\Documents and Settings\whtai>emca -config dbcontrol db
EMCA 开始于 2009-8-31 16:48:45
EM Configuration Assistant, 11.1.0.5.0 正式版
版权所有 (c) 2003, 2005, Oracle。保留所有权利。
输入以下信息:
数据库 SID: orcl
已为数据库 orcl 配置了 Database Control
您已选择配置 Database Control, 以便管理数据库 orcl
此操作将移去现有配置和默认设置, 并重新执行配置
是否继续? [是(Y)/否(N)]: y
监听程序端口号: 1521
SYS 用户的口令:
DBSNMP 用户的口令: 56
SYSMAN 用户的口令:
通知的电子邮件地址 (可选):
通知的发件 (SMTP) 服务器 (可选):
-----------------------------------------------------------------
已指定以下设置
数据库 ORACLE_HOME ................ C:\app\whtai\product\11.1.0\db_1
本地主机名 ................ 192.168.11.74
监听程序端口号 ................ 1521
数据库 SID ................ orcl
通知的电子邮件地址 ...............
通知的发件 (SMTP) 服务器 ...............
-----------------------------------------------------------------
是否继续? [是(Y)/否(N)]: y
2009-8-31 16:51:07 oracle.sysman.emcp.EMConfig perform
信息: 正在将此操作记录到 C:\app\whtai\cfgtoollogs\emca\orcl\emca_2009_08_31_16_4
8_44.log。
2009-8-31 16:51:36 oracle.sysman.emcp.util.DBControlUtil stopOMS
信息: 正在停止 Database Control (此操作可能需要一段时间)...
2009-8-31 16:53:34 oracle.sysman.emcp.EMReposConfig uploadConfigDataToRepository
信息: 正在将配置数据上载到 EM 资料档案库 (此操作可能需要一段时间)...
2009-8-31 16:56:44 oracle.sysman.emcp.EMReposConfig invoke
信息: 已成功上载配置数据
2009-8-31 16:56:58 oracle.sysman.emcp.util.DBControlUtil configureSoftwareLib
信息: 软件库已配置。
2009-8-31 16:56:58 oracle.sysman.emcp.util.DBControlUtil configureSoftwareLib
信息: 将忽略 EM_SWLIB_STAGE_LOC (值)。
2009-8-31 16:56:59 oracle.sysman.emcp.util.DBControlUtil secureDBConsole
信息: 正在保护 Database Control (此操作可能需要一段时间)...
2009-8-31 16:57:15 oracle.sysman.emcp.util.DBControlUtil secureDBConsole
信息: 已成功保护 Database Control。
2009-8-31 16:57:15 oracle.sysman.emcp.util.DBControlUtil startOMS
信息: 正在启动 Database Control (此操作可能需要一段时间)...
2009-8-31 16:59:16 oracle.sysman.emcp.EMDBPostConfig performConfiguration
信息: 已成功启动 Database Control
2009-8-31 16:59:18 oracle.sysman.emcp.EMDBPostConfig performConfiguration
信息: >>>>>>>>>>> Database Control URL 为 https://192.168.11.74:1158/em <<<<<<<<
<<<
2009-8-31 16:59:29 oracle.sysman.emcp.EMDBPostConfig invoke
警告:
************************ WARNING ************************
管理资料档案库已置于安全模式下, 在此模式下将对 Enterprise Manager 数据进行加密。
加密密钥已放置在文件 C:\app\whtai\product\11.1.0\db_1\192.168.11.74_orcl\sysman\
config\emkey.ora 中。请务必备份此文件, 因为如果此文件丢失, 则加密数据将不可用。
***********************************************************
已成功完成 Enterprise Manager 的配置
EMCA 结束于 2009-8-31 16:59:29